Discover Livorno, a charming coastal city in Tuscany that beautifully blends rich history and vibrant seaside culture. Stroll along the picturesque canals of the Venezia Nuova district, marvel at the impressive Fortezza Nuova, and indulge in fresh seafood at local trattorias. Relax on sun-kissed beaches like Spiaggia del Sale or explore the stunning nearby islands of the Tuscan Archipelago. With its lively atmosphere, artistic heritage, and breathtaking Mediterranean views, Livorno is the perfect off-the-beaten-path destination for travelers seeking a unique Italian experience. Livorno exper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 47.3°F (8.5°C), while August is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 76.8°F (24.9°C). November is usually the wettest month. April, July, and September are the peak travel months in Livorno,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is sunny to mostly sunny, accompanied by no to light rainfall. On the other hand, October to December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
